OBUSD: Stability for Builders, Backed by Grants.

Imagine a world where building on a blockchain doesn’t mean waiting forever for money. Meet OBUSD, the big helper for builders in 2025. Instead of making developers wait a long time for grant money, OBUSD offers a smart way to get needed money quickly.Here's how it works: Builders put in stablecoins, like USDC, into OBUSD. It’s not just about keeping money safe—it’s about making more money through DeFi lending pools. The extra money made is shared with projects that need it, giving builders money when they need it most. "You don’t have to wait anymore – OBUSD makes it automatic," says Ruben from OBUSD.What makes OBUSD special is how it uses attestations and endorsements. This makes getting money simpler. When a project gets a grant okay and some thumbs-up from Optimism citizens, it gets monthly money, making things much easier for builders. But OBUSD is more than just a tool—it’s a team builder. By sharing money among projects, it turns tough times into team efforts. Builders aren’t alone; they're on a team, sharing ideas and help through the OBUSD platform.In a world where old ways of grants can’t keep up with fast changes, OBUSD gives a new way that isn’t just about hope, but real support. It’s a step to a better, friendly future for building on blockchains.Is OBUSD the future of getting money? Its smart way makes it a question worth thinking about. DevNTell Builder Series - Fostering Economic Development On-Chain with Locale Network feat. Founder Trez

In this special builder series edition of DevNTell we're joined by Trez whose the founder of Locale Network. Locale Network is nn ecosystem on L3 Data Networks called City-Chains. Focusing on Economic development through DePIN, DeFi, and Smart City services. Viewers of this DevNTell will see Trez give an exciting talk around the history of community cooperatives, parallel currencies, and their vision to bridge Web3 liquidity to local communities for a modern spin on age-old economic development models. The Oracle Behind A New Wave of RWAs Onchain

Jakub Wojciechowski and Marcin Kaźmierczak are the CoFounders of RedStone. In this episode, we explore how RedStone is powering the next generation of RWAs onchain, from stablecoins to Apollo's private credit onchain issued by Securitize. PMFers with David Phelps

In this episode, we sit down with David Phelps—co-founder of JokeRace—to trace his journey from Craigslist tutoring gigs to designing experimental onchain voting systems with real users and real incentives. David shares how building a Stripe-powered tutoring DAO before DAOs were cool helped him see the future of crypto, and how a silly game about bad jokes on Twitter turned into a full-blown governance product used by the Ethereum Foundation. We get into the weeds on distribution, incentives, and why rivalries—not kumbaya—are the key to real community.
